#include "Quad.h"
Definition at line 219 of file Quad.h.
FloatIndefQuad::FloatIndefQuad | ( | float_integrand_fcn | fcn | ) | [inline] |
FloatIndefQuad::FloatIndefQuad | ( | float_integrand_fcn | fcn, | |
double | b, | |||
IntegralType | t | |||
) | [inline] |
double FloatIndefQuad::do_integrate | ( | octave_idx_type & | ier, | |
octave_idx_type & | neval, | |||
double & | abserr | |||
) | [virtual] |
float FloatIndefQuad::do_integrate | ( | octave_idx_type & | ier, | |
octave_idx_type & | neval, | |||
float & | abserr | |||
) | [virtual] |
Implements Quad.
Definition at line 259 of file Quad.cc.
References bound, bound_to_inf, doubly_infinite, F77_XFCN, Quad::ff, float_user_fcn, float_user_function(), Array< T >::fortran_vec(), neg_inf_to_bound, qagi(), and type.
virtual float Quad::float_integrate | ( | octave_idx_type & | ier | ) | [inline, virtual, inherited] |
virtual float Quad::float_integrate | ( | octave_idx_type & | ier, | |
octave_idx_type & | neval | |||
) | [inline, virtual, inherited] |
virtual float Quad::float_integrate | ( | octave_idx_type & | ier, | |
octave_idx_type & | neval, | |||
float & | abserr | |||
) | [inline, virtual, inherited] |
virtual float Quad::float_integrate | ( | void | ) | [inline, virtual, inherited] |
Definition at line 69 of file Quad.h.
Referenced by DEFUN_DLD().
virtual double Quad::integrate | ( | octave_idx_type & | ier | ) | [inline, virtual, inherited] |
virtual double Quad::integrate | ( | octave_idx_type & | ier, | |
octave_idx_type & | neval | |||
) | [inline, virtual, inherited] |
virtual double Quad::integrate | ( | octave_idx_type & | ier, | |
octave_idx_type & | neval, | |||
double & | abserr | |||
) | [inline, virtual, inherited] |
virtual double Quad::integrate | ( | void | ) | [inline, virtual, inherited] |
Definition at line 62 of file Quad.h.
Referenced by DEFUN_DLD().
float FloatIndefQuad::bound [private] |
Definition at line 241 of file Quad.h.
Referenced by do_integrate().
integrand_fcn Quad::f [protected, inherited] |
Definition at line 118 of file Quad.h.
Referenced by IndefQuad::do_integrate(), and DefQuad::do_integrate().
float_integrand_fcn Quad::ff [protected, inherited] |
Definition at line 119 of file Quad.h.
Referenced by do_integrate(), and FloatDefQuad::do_integrate().
int FloatIndefQuad::integration_error [private] |
IntegralType FloatIndefQuad::type [private] |
Definition at line 242 of file Quad.h.
Referenced by do_integrate().